Baked date pudding
Prep: 10 min Cook: 40 min Servings: 6by Peter Brown100 recipes>A Cape Malay recipe as reproduced on I Africa "an olden time dessert learnt from granny." It always takes me back to my very young childhood days when I used to spend rainy days in my gran's large old kitchen in Bredasdorp with its wood-burning stove, keeping warm and enjoying the smells that came from the oven. Ingredients
- 1x250g stoneless dates
- ½ teaspoon bicarbonate of soda
- 4 cups self-raising flour
- `/2 teaspoon ground mixed spice
- 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
- A pinch of salt
- 90g soft butter
- ½ cup soft brown sugar
- 2 large eggs, beaten
- 250ml milk
- 1 tablespoon oil
- A pinch of salt
Directions
- Cream the butter, sugar and egg together.
- Add the milk, oil and salt.
- Mix the dry ingredients together except the dates and add the egg mixture
- Add the dates to the mixture and mix well.
- Turn out on a greased ovenproof dish.
- Bake on the middle shelf at 180 degrees Celsius for 40 minutes and serve with custard.
